Where each one falls short

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.

Betterment

  • Digital automated investing charges $5 per month fee for accounts under $24,000 balance
  • Premium advisory service requires minimum balance of $100,000 in eligible investments
  • Foreign transaction fees apply to checking account (though reimbursed after the fact)
  • High-balance fee discounts only available above $1,000,000 account balance

Monzo

  • Monzo is UK-focused, so customers wanting deep multi-currency holding, broad international transfers or in-app investing will find its feature set narrower than Revolut.
  • Overdraft and loan products carry interest charges based on individually assessed rates, and like any consumer credit product the cost varies by risk profile rather than being a flat, predictable fee.
  • Free ATM withdrawals abroad are capped at a monthly limit on the free tier, after which a fee applies, so heavy cash users abroad may find the free tier insufficient.
  • As an app-first bank with very limited physical presence, customers who prefer in-person branch banking or need to deposit cash regularly will find it inconvenient compared with a traditional high street bank.
  • Some paid-tier perks, such as travel insurance bundled into Premium, require reading policy terms carefully, since bundled insurance products can have narrower cover than a standalone policy bought separately.

Answered from the vendors’ own pages

Betterment: What is the minimum to start investing with Betterment?

Betterment requires only $10 to open an account and begin either automated or self-directed investing.

Source
Monzo: Is Monzo a real bank?

Yes, Monzo Bank Limited holds a full UK banking licence and is regulated by the FCA and PRA, the same framework as traditional UK banks.

Betterment: How much does Betterment's Premium Service cost?

Premium Service charges an additional 0.40% fee on your invested balances and requires a minimum account balance of $100,000.

Source
Monzo: Are my savings protected if Monzo fails?

Eligible deposits are covered by the Financial Services Compensation Scheme up to 85,000 pounds per eligible person, the same statutory protection as other UK banks.

Betterment: What APY does Betterment's High-Yield Cash offer?

High-Yield Cash offers 3.25% base APY plus a new customer boost of 0.75% APY (up to $1M) through January 15, 2027, totaling 4.00% promotional APY.

Source
Monzo: Does Monzo charge for spending abroad?

No card fee applies for purchases abroad at the interbank exchange rate; free ATM withdrawals abroad are capped at a monthly limit before a fee applies.

Betterment: Does Betterment charge a wrap fee on self-directed accounts?

No, Betterment waives its wrap fee for self-directed investing accounts, allowing customers to invest without advisory fees.
